背单词软件数据库ER图技术解析
背单词软件是一个非常实用的工具,其中数据的存储是非常重要的一环。在本文中,我们将探讨背单词软件数据库ER图的技术细节,以及如何实现一个完善的背单词软件。
ER图全称实体关系图,是数据模型中最常见的图形化表示方法。它展示了实体、属性和实体之间的关系,使数据模型更加可读可理解。在背单词软件中,我们可以通过ER图来设计和管理单词、例句、翻译等数据的存储结构,方便用户进行有效的背诵。
在设计背单词软件数据库ER图之前,我们需要确定数据存储的需求。根据一般的背单词软件功能,我们可以将数据分为四个主要部分:单词、例句、词汇本和用户。每个部分都有自己的属性和关系,我们可以根据这些信息,设计出如下ER图。
在上图中,我们定义了四个实体:Word(单词)、Sentence(例句)、Vocabulary(词汇本)和User(用户)。每个实体都有与之相关的属性和关系。
其中,单词实体Word有名称和音标两个属性。此外,Word还与例句实体Sentence有一对多的关系,表示一个单词可以拥有多个例句。
例句实体Sentence有句子和翻译两个属性。此外,Sentence还与单词实体Word有多对一的关系,表示一个例句只属于一个单词。
词汇本实体Vocabulary有名称、描述和所有者三个属性。